Pros

The benefits were great. I had coverage for everything, even my pets. It's a good learning environment, some of the nurses and supervisors there really care (others not so much). Plenty of units to work, float option is easy to use. Scheduling was usually a breeze, extra shifts were always available. Very diverse.

Cons

Beware: The starting pay for new grad RN's is the lowest in the state in one of the most expensive places to live in the country. Don't expect to get much more then that. No pay increase for getting your BSN. Minimal raises every year, you have to use of a tricky clinical ladder to make ends meet. Not a lot of support if you start making mistakes once you're off RN residency. They'll hang you out to dry in a second.
